  • Indulge in the comforting flavours of autumn with this delightful Spiced Pumpkin Waffle recipe, perfectly complemented by a luscious brown butter maple syrup. Begin by whisking together flour, baking powder, and a warm medley of spices—think cinnamon, nutmeg, and ginger—to create a fragrant dry mix. In a separate bowl, combine pumpkin puree with eggs, milk, and a hint of vanilla, before folding in the dry ingredients to achieve a velvety batter.

    As the waffles cook to golden perfection, prepare the brown butter maple syrup by gently melting butter until it turns a rich amber colour, releasing a nutty aroma. Stir in pure maple syrup and a pinch of salt to elevate the flavour. Serve the waffles warm, drizzled generously with the decadent syrup, and perhaps finish off with a dollop of whipped cream or a sprinkle of chopped nuts for added texture. This seasonal treat is sure to warm hearts and bellies alike!

  • Apple crisp is a delightful dessert that celebrates the flavours of autumn, making it the perfect treat for those cooler evenings. To begin, gather your ingredients: firm, tart apples such as Bramley or Granny Smith, sugar, a touch of cinnamon, and a crunchy topping made from oats, flour, butter, and more sugar.

    Start by peeling and slicing the apples, then toss them in a bowl with sugar and cinnamon to enhance their natural sweetness. Next, prepare the crumble topping by mixing together the flour, oats, and sugar before rubbing in the butter until the mixture resembles breadcrumbs.

    Layer the apple mixture in a baking dish and evenly spread the crumble over the top. Bake in a preheated oven until the apples are tender and the topping is golden brown. Serve warm, perhaps with a generous scoop of vanilla ice cream or a dollop of clotted cream. This comforting dessert is sure to warm hearts and fill kitchens with a wonderful aroma. Enjoy the simple pleasures of this classic British recipe!

  • The Simple Black Forest Cake is a delightful indulgence that captures the essence of rich, chocolatey goodness intertwined with the tangy sweetness of cherries. Originating from the Black Forest region in Germany, this classic dessert typically features layers of moist chocolate sponge, generously filled and topped with whipped cream and glistening cherries.

    To create this sumptuous cake, one begins by baking a light chocolate cake, ensuring it remains fluffy and tender. Once cooled, the cake is sliced into even layers, each generously soaked with a hint of cherry liqueur or syrup to enhance the flavour. A luscious layer of whipped cream is spread between each layer, sandwiching the cherries that burst with juiciness, while the exterior is decorated with more cream and a scattering of chocolate shavings for that decadent finish.

    Perfect for celebrations or a comforting treat, this delightful cake embodies the harmonious blend of chocolate and cherry that has made it a beloved favourite across the ages. Whether enjoyed with a cup of tea or as a grand finale to a meal, the Simple Black Forest Cake is a sweet testament to the art of baking.

  • Indulging your sweet tooth doesn’t have to derail your healthy eating goals. Here are seven delightful treats, all under 150 calories, that promise to satisfy your cravings without the guilt.

    1. Greek Yogurt with Honey: A small serving of low-fat Greek yogurt drizzled with a teaspoon of honey provides a creamy, tangy delight, clocking in at around 120 calories.

    2. Dark Chocolate Square: One rich square of dark chocolate (about 70% cocoa) is both luxurious and healthful, offering antioxidants while containing roughly 50-90 calories.

    3. Frozen Fruit Bar: Many brands offer puréed fruit bars that are refreshing and low in calories—typically around 60-100 calories—perfect for a warm day.

    4. Apple Slices with Nut Butter: Enjoy a medium apple sliced and paired with half a tablespoon of almond or peanut butter for a satisfying crunch and sweetness, at around 140 calories.

    5. Mini Rice Cakes with Nutella: A couple of plain rice cakes topped with a thin layer of Nutella come in at just under 150 calories, offering a light, crunchy treat.

    6. Homemade Fruit Smoothie: Blend half a banana with a handful of berries and a splash of almond milk for a refreshing smoothie that can be enjoyed for about 100 calories.

    7. Baked Cinnamon Apple: Slice an apple, sprinkle it with cinnamon, and bake until tender for a warming dessert that’s wholesome and around 70 calories.

    These tasty treats prove that satisfying your sweet cravings can indeed be light and wholesome!
